Virtual Resource Planner
Location: Remote Annual Salary: $85,571 Position Overview: We seek a detail-oriented and proactive Virtual Resource Planner to join our dynamic team. This remote position is crucial in ensuring our resources are effectively allocated and managed to support project execution and operational excellence. The ideal candidate will possess strong organizational skills, excellent communication abilities, and a strategic mindset, enabling them to navigate the complexities of resource planning in a virtual environment. Key Responsibilities:- Resource Allocation and Management:
- Develop and maintain a comprehensive resource allocation plan that aligns with project timelines and objectives.
- Monitor resource utilization to ensure optimal efficiency and productivity, identify potential bottlenecks, and propose solutions.
- Collaborate with project managers to understand resource requirements for upcoming projects and adjust allocations as necessary.
- Data Analysis and Reporting:
- Utilize data analytics tools to assess resource performance and productivity metrics.
- Prepare regular reports on resource allocation, availability, and performance, providing insights to senior management for strategic decision-making.
- Conduct trend analysis to forecast resource needs and prepare for upcoming projects or peak times.
- Collaboration and Communication:
- Serve as the primary point of contact for project managers and team leads regarding resource availability and allocation.
- Facilitate regular meetings to discuss resource needs, share updates, and address any concerns or changes in project scope.
- Foster a collaborative environment by working closely with cross-functional teams to ensure alignment and clarity in resource planning.
- Process Improvement:
- Identify and implement best practices for resource planning processes, enhancing efficiency and effectiveness.
- Develop and maintain documentation for resource planning procedures and guidelines, ensuring clarity and consistency across the organization.
- Stay abreast of industry trends and tools that can improve resource planning methodologies and software solutions.
- Crisis Management:
- Proactively identify potential resource shortages or conflicts, developing contingency plans to mitigate risks.
- Address urgent resource-related issues as they arise, ensuring minimal project timelines and deliverables disruption.
- Lead the response to resource allocation challenges during critical project phases, adapting quickly to changing circumstances.
- Stakeholder Engagement:
- Engage with stakeholders at all levels to gather feedback and understand their resource needs and expectations.
- Build and maintain strong relationships with internal teams, promoting a culture of transparency and collaboration in resource management.
- Actively participate in project kick-off meetings to ensure all resource needs are captured and addressed.
